Kampung Kasa, Pasir Mas, Kelantan
Kampung Kasa in Pasir Mas, Kelantan recorded 7 subsale transactions in 2024, with a median price of RM340K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M102.
This area contains both residential and commercial properties. View 3 residential properties or 1 commercial properties separately for more focused analysis.
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M340K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M302K to RM405K, and a typical market range of RM311K to RM369K.
Most transactions involved 1 - 1 1/2 storey semi-detached, with moderate diversity in property types available.
Price per square foot shows a median of RM102, though individual units vary from RM75 to RM128 in the core range. The broader market spans RM90.31 to RM113.31, indicating diverse property characteristics. A wider spread (IQR: RM23.00) and deviation (MAD: RM26) indicate significant PSF variations, likely due to diverse property types or conditions.
